I don't expect the Championship missions to deviate significantly from the philosophy of last year's - you can likely expect each mission to include a board control condition (table quarters, seize ground style objectives, hold terrain pieces - things like that) and a "kill the enemy" condition (KPs, VPs, kill all Troops, etc.). The third condition will vary, and usually could be assigned to one of those categories (kill the HQ, hold the center of the board).

Last year's missions are a good place to start.

This is correct. All the major changes to the rules for this event took place last year and the mission format will be similar to 2011. Last year we released a document containing all the possible mission objectives, but they were not formatted into actual missions. This was done on March 24th, so just a couple of weeks prior to the event. You might see something like this again this year and a bit sooner.

That said, the 2011 missions are the best place to start and will get you 85% of the way there.

Complete rules, 2011 missions and all that good stuff can be found here.

The 2012 Gladiator Primer missions have been posted, and the 40K Team Tournament ones should be up after March 3rd.

The Dev Blog has been, and will be, very active over the next month or so. There will be a post detailing the minor/major changes in the 40K Team Tournament and possibly something discussing the 40K Champs, although aside from Sportsmanship scoring, not much has changed.
